Shoshone County Swimming Pools Overview Water Quality and Safety Standards Examined Top Recommendations for Enhancing Community Pool Facilities

Recent assessments of Shoshone County’s swimming pools reveal a strong commitment to maintaining high water quality and safety standards across public and community facilities. Routine checks confirm that chlorine levels and pH balances are consistently within recommended parameters, effectively minimizing bacterial risks and ensuring a safe swimming environment. Lifeguard training programs have been upgraded to align with the latest American Red Cross certifications, emphasizing swift response to emergencies and enhanced supervision. However, challenges persist with occasional fluctuations in water clarity, prompting officials to review filtration systems and pool maintenance schedules.

To further elevate the community’s aquatic facilities, key recommendations include:

  • Installation of advanced UV filtration systems to complement traditional chlorination and reduce chemical usage.
  • Improved signage and safety information throughout pool areas to enhance visitor awareness and compliance.
  • Expanded community outreach programs focused on swimming lessons and water safety education, targeting all age groups.
FacilityWater Quality RatingSafety Measures
Osburn PoolExcellentCertified Lifeguards & UV Filters
Kellogg Community PoolGoodRegular Maintenance & Updated Signage
Wallace Aquatic CenterFairPending Filter Upgrades & Training
